Information on 071 class To See what the liveries look like click on the descriptions: Built : 1976 by General Motors, La Grange, Illinois, U.S.A. Engine : General Motors 12 -cylinder 645 E3C developing of 1830 kW (2450 able for traction). Transmission : Electric. 6 axle hung nose suspended general motors (D77B traction motors). Max. Tractive Effort : 289 kN (65000 ibf). Cont. Tractive Effort : 192 kN (42390ibf) at 15.1 m.p.h. Power at Rail : 1360 kW (1823 h.p.). Weight : 99 tons Length Over Buffers : 17.37 m (57 feet) Wheel Diameter : 1016 mm (3 feet 4 inches). Train Brakes : Air & Vacuum Multiple Working : with all IE & NIR general motors locos
****
- 071 & 111 CLASS ARE NOT ALLOWED TO WORK IN MULTIPLE ON IE OR NIR TRACK -
****
Maximum Speed : 90 m.p.h.
Named Loco's : 082 CUMANN NA nINNEALTOIRI /
THE INSITUTION OF ENGINEERS OF IRELAND
Passenger Turns for 071 Class : Class 071's have no booked workings out of Dublin Connolly or Dublin Heuston. But you may find them on passenger workings out of Dublin Heuston Station, they work due to shortage of 201 class.
